Knights Templar rotten > Library > Conspiracy > Knights Templar According to legend, the Knights Templar was founded in 1118 to protect tourists headed for Jerusalem. There the small band of warrior monks established a headquarters. Even though the Templars swore allegiance to the Pope, their beliefs were not exactly orthodox. But when they weren't busy doing that, they managed to amass a financial empire with vast holdings. By the dawn of the 14th century, the Knights Templar had become Europe's dominant religious order. In France, King Philip IV owed the Templars a lot of money, which he didn't really feel like repaying. Some of the Templars escaped to Portugal, where (for a few years) they enjoyed the protection of its king. The Pope forcibly disbanded their organization in March 1312, announced in a Papal Bull accusing the Templars of having fallen "into the sin of impious apostasy, the abominable vice of idolatry, the deadly crime of the Sodomites, and various heresies."

You’ll start by drilling a hole at the top of the plastic box. Use a drill bit that is one size larger than the diameter of the bolt on the knob, otherwise the plastic might crack. Open the lid and slowly drill a hole in the center of the box with very light pressure. Push the knob through the hole of the box and replace the washer and nut. Voila! Make your own a painted bangle bracelet! I made this super cute and simple accessory project this afternoon! You'll need at least one blank wood bangle bracelet, some acrylic paint and a paint brush. Step 1: Use a light color to prime a 'background' area on your bangle. I used two coats. Acrylic paint dries extremely fast (usually within about 10 minutes). Step 2: Paint XOs (or any cute design) in varied paint colors all the way around your bracelet. Step 3: Let dry and seal with an acrylic paint sealer if desired. Wear it or give it as a gift! XO!
